Landmarks from digital photo collections
First Claim
Patent Images
1. A method to detect landmarks in digital images, comprising:
- assigning, by one or more processors, to one or more images in a plurality of text-associated digital images, a text tag descriptive of a landmark feature, wherein the text tag is based upon one or more n-grams from one or more texts associated with the one or more images, wherein the n-grams are scored based on image-name links between the one or more n-grams and the one or more images, wherein each of the image-name links is a variable indicative of whether the one or more n-grams are included in text tags of the one or more images;
building an appearance model for the landmark feature based on the assigned text tag descriptive of the landmark feature; and
detecting the landmark feature in a different image using the appearance model.
2 Assignments
0 Petitions
Accused Products
Abstract
Methods and systems for automatic detection of landmarks in digital images and annotation of those images are disclosed. A method for detecting and annotating landmarks in digital images includes the steps of automatically assigning a tag descriptive of a landmark to one or more images in a plurality of text-associated digital images to generate a set of landmark-tagged images, learning an appearance model for the landmark from the set of landmark-tagged images, and detecting the landmark in a new digital image using the appearance model. The method can also include a step of annotating the new image with the tag descriptive of the landmark.
-
Citations
20 Claims
-
1. A method to detect landmarks in digital images, comprising:
-
assigning, by one or more processors, to one or more images in a plurality of text-associated digital images, a text tag descriptive of a landmark feature, wherein the text tag is based upon one or more n-grams from one or more texts associated with the one or more images, wherein the n-grams are scored based on image-name links between the one or more n-grams and the one or more images, wherein each of the image-name links is a variable indicative of whether the one or more n-grams are included in text tags of the one or more images; building an appearance model for the landmark feature based on the assigned text tag descriptive of the landmark feature; and detecting the landmark feature in a different image using the appearance model.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. A system to detect landmarks in digital images, comprising:
-
one or more processors; and a non-transitory computer-readable medium having instructions stored thereon, the instructions executable by the one or more processors to; assign to one or more images in a plurality of text-associated digital images a text tag descriptive of a landmark object, wherein the text tag is based upon one or more n-grams from one or more texts associated with the one or more images that are scored based on image-name links between the one or more n-grams and the one or more images, wherein the image-name links are variables indicative of whether the one or more n-grams are included in text tags of the one or more images; learn an appearance model for the landmark object from the assigned text tag; detect the landmark object in a new image using the appearance model; and annotate the new image with the assigned text tag descriptive of the landmark object. - View Dependent Claims (12, 13, 14, 15, 16, 17, 18, 19)
-
-
20. A method to detect landmarks in digital images, comprising:
-
assigning, by one or more processors, to one or more images in a plurality of text-associated digital images, a text tag descriptive of a landmark feature, wherein the text tag is based upon one or more n-grams from one or more texts associated with the one or more images, wherein the n-grams are scored based on image-name links between the one or more n-grams and the one or more images and wherein the assigning comprises assigning correlation weights to each of the plurality of text-associated digital images based on correlation of text associated with each image with text associated with one or more other images in the plurality of text-associated digital images; building an appearance model for the landmark feature based on the assigned text tag descriptive of the landmark feature; and detecting the landmark feature in a different image using the appearance model.
-
Specification